ClearLight Partners

ClearLight Partners LLC, established in 2000 and headquartered in Newport Beach, California, is a private equity firm focusing on mid-market investments. The firm specializes in management-led industry consolidations, growth capital, and recapitalization, primarily investing in companies based in the United States and Canada. ClearLight Partners targets companies with revenues between $10 million and $250 million, operating income/EBITDA between $3 million and $15 million, and enterprise values between $10 million and $100 million. The firm seeks to take majority stakes in investments, holding them for five to seven years. Since inception, ClearLight Partners has raised over $900 million across three funds and invested in over 15 platform companies. The firm's investment focus spans specialty manufacturing, industrial technology, consumer products and services, healthcare services, business services, and education and training sectors.

Handel’s Homemade Ice Cream

Private Equity Round in 2019
Handel's Homemade Ice Cream and Yogurt, founded in 1945 and based in Youngstown, Ohio, operates a chain of ice cream shops across the United States. The company specializes in producing and selling homemade ice cream, made fresh daily on the premises using unique recipes and proprietary methods. Each batch is crafted in specialized freezers designed to achieve a distinctively smooth and creamy texture. Handel's offers a diverse selection of flavors, including cherry vanilla, chunky chocolate chip, strawberry cheesecake, and caramel apple, ensuring that customers enjoy high-quality, freshly made products.

Taymax

Private Equity Round in 2013
Taymax is a multi-unit franchisee of Planet Fitness health clubs located throughout North America. Taymax owns and operates over 30 Planet Fitness clubs in the greater San Antonio, Nashville, Pittsburgh, Sacramento, Toronto, and Ottawa regions. Taymax is one of the largest and fastest-growing franchisees within the Planet Fitness system. With more than 1,000 locations, Planet Fitness (NYSE: PLNT) is one of the largest and most popular fitness chains in the world. Planet Fitness possesses a highly recognized brand in the low-cost, high-value segment of the market. Its core mission is to enhance people’s lives by providing a high-quality fitness experience in a welcoming, non-intimidating environment, which it calls the Judgement Free Zone®. More than 90% of Planet Fitness stores are owned and operated by independent franchisees.

Intoxalock

Acquisition in 2012
Intoxalock, based in Des Moines, Iowa, specializes in providing reliable alcohol monitoring devices, particularly ignition interlock systems. These devices meet state requirements in over 40 states and are utilized across all 50 states. Intoxalock was developed in collaboration with researchers at Iowa State University, with its ignition interlock device first introduced in 1992 by Consumer Safety Technology LLC (CST), which pioneered the use of alcohol-specific fuel cell technology in the industry. This advanced technology has become a standard in ignition interlock devices. In 2012, CST rebranded and began operating under the Intoxalock name, continuing its commitment to professional service and customer satisfaction.

U.S. Education Corporation

Private Equity Round in 2003
U.S. Education Corporation was formed in partnership with leading education industry executives to acquire, develop, and grow private career colleges throughout the Western United States. ClearLight Partners provided initial funding for U.S. Education in June 2002 to fund the acquisition of Silicon Valley College, an allied healthcare and information technology school in the San Francisco Bay area. In 2003, ClearLight Partners provided U.S. Education additional capital for, and assistance with, three acquisitions including Western Career College (February 2003), American Institute of Healthcare Technology (October 2003), and Apollo College(December 2003). As a result, U.S. Education grew from a four-campus school in Northern California to a leading career education company with seventeen campuses across the Western U.S. and a dominant position in allied healthcare training. ClearLight Partners has provided active assistance to U.S. Education in evaluating and executing acquisitions, arranging debt financing, strategic planning, and filling key management positions. ClearLight exited its investment in U.S. Education in 2008.
